Can I study part-time while completing the 9 months Level 6 Diploma in Information Technology (fast-track)?

Yes, you can study part-time while completing the Level 6 Diploma in Information Technology (fast-track) program. The program is designed to be flexible and accommodating to students with various schedules and commitments.

By studying part-time, you will have the opportunity to balance your education with other responsibilities such as work or family. This can be a great option for those who need to maintain a job while furthering their education in the field of Information Technology.

It is important to note that while studying part-time may extend the duration of the program, it allows for a more manageable workload and can lead to a more successful learning experience.
